TERMINATION MATERIAL:
D2 - D5 and D2X - D5X Sizes
Base: Fe (~ 100µm)
Under Plating: Cu (~ 5µm)
Finish Plating: Sn (5 ~ 9µm)
D2Z - D6Z Sizes
Base: Cu (~ 105µm)
Finish Plating: Sn (5 ~ 9µm)

DURATION ABOVE 200°C (FOR 240°C REFLOW PARTS)
If Peak Soldering Temperature is
240°C
230°C
220°C
Maximum Time Above +200°C is
30 seconds
40 seconds
50 seconds
DURATION ABOVE 230°C (FOR 260°C REFLOW PARTS)
If Peak Soldering Temperature is
260°C
255°C
250°C
Maximum Time Above +230°C is
40 seconds
50 seconds
60 seconds
Notes:
1. SAC alloy (+217°C) reflow soldering compatible
2. Soldering heat limits apply to the top surface of component
3. If you have concerns about your reflow soldering profile review them with NIC
to insure compatible [tpmg@niccomp.com]
4. Two passes through the reflow process are allowed (cooling down period
between process).
